AbbVie (ABBV) Stock Sinks As Market Gains: What You Should Know

In the latest trading session, AbbVie (ABBV) closed at $78.60, marking a -0.11% move from the previous day. This change lagged the S&P 500's daily gain of 0.09%. Meanwhile, the Dow gained 0.09%, and the Nasdaq, a tech-heavy index, added 0.62%.

Coming into today, shares of the drugmaker had lost 1.02% in the past month. In that same time, the Medical sector gained 3.37%, while the S&P 500 gained 2.08%.

ABBV will be looking to display strength as it nears its next earnings release. In that report, analysts expect ABBV to post earnings of $2.21 per share. This would mark year-over-year growth of 10.5%. Our most recent consensus estimate is calling for quarterly revenue of $8.08 billion, down 2.39% from the year-ago period.

ABBV's full-year Zacks Consensus Estimates are calling for earnings of $8.81 per share and revenue of $32.77 billion. These results would represent year-over-year changes of +11.38% and +0.04%, respectively.

In terms of valuation, ABBV is currently trading at a Forward P/E ratio of 8.93. For comparison, its industry has an average Forward P/E of 14.56, which means ABBV is trading at a discount to the group.

We can also see that ABBV currently has a PEG ratio of 1.61. This metric is used similarly to the famous P/E ratio, but the PEG ratio also takes into account the stock's expected earnings growth rate. The Large Cap Pharmaceuticals industry currently had an average PEG ratio of 2.11 as of yesterday's close.
